DAYTON, Ohio (WDTN) – The 15th Annual Maria Stein Shrine's Art Show is coming up soon.
The event will be held at the Maria Stein Shrine of the Holy Relics on 2291 St. John's Rd. It will start on Tuesday, June 17 and run through Monday, June 30. The gallery will be in the Upper Room (on the third floor).

There will be a fine selection of art on display, some of which will be for sale. Attendees can cast a vote for their favorite piece, which will receive the People's Choice Award.
There will be art in three categories.
Painting: which is oils, acrylics, water media and watercolors.
Drawing: which is graphite, charcoal, colored pencil, pastels and pen/ink.
Three-dimensional: which is glass works, ceramics and sculptures.

DAYTON, Ohio (WDTN) – The massive Poultry Days festival in Versailles, is attempting to break the world record for the World's Largest Chicken BBQ in a single day. The 74th Annual festival will run from June 13 to June 15. It routinely brings in crowds of over 50,000 people. This year, the event wants to break the world record for the largest chicken BBQ. Organizers said they have two semi-truck loads of chicken, and over 16,000 halves will be cooked. It has run for 73 years without interruption, including a modified version durning the 2020 pandemic, and it has served over 1.2 million dinners. There will be a four-lane drive/walk-through station for chicken on 459 S. Center St. It will open at 3:30 p.m. on Friday, 11:30 a.m. on Saturday and 11:00 a.m. on Sunday. Pre-purchased bulk coolers will be available at Versailles Exempted Village School, 280 Marker Rd. SPRINGFIELD, Ohio (WDTN) — The Summer Arts Festival is returning to Springfield this weekend. The 59th annual Summer Arts Festival begins Thursday, June 12 and will run through July 12. Attendees can visit the Veterans Park Amphitheater in Springfield for a variety of events and entertainment. Lawn chairs and blankets are encouraged to enjoy the outdoor entertainment. Various food trucks and concession stands will be available. Attendees can also donate to help support local performing arts. The event and all shows are free of charge. Various themes and live entertainment are planned throughout the summer.
